Parliament allows remote investiture of the presidency of the Government of Catalonia

Breaches:



Parliament’s Plenary Session approves a modification in Presidency Law to enable the investiture of the Presidency of the Government of Catalonia remotely -without a candidate being physically present- during the investiture debate. This was approved through the single reading procedure with favourable votes of JxCat, ERC and CUP, in a reform proposal submitted by JxCat on 9 February. On 26 April, the Council of Statutory Guarantees, at the request of Ciudadanos and PSC, ruled that this reform violates the Statute and the Constitution.
